| Anonymous Coward User ID: 1517806 08/24/2011 10:05 PM Report Abusive Post Report Copyright Violation | WASHINGTON – A commentator on the Russian government-funded television news network RT boasted of a $1 million "money bomb" on behalf of U.S. Rep. Ron Paul, R-Texas, a candidate for the Republican presidential nomination. The donation raises legal questions, because while the commentator happens to be an American, allowing him to donate to Paul's presidential campaign, foreign entities such as RT are prohibited. "I'd like to end tonight on a note of some good news," said Adam Kokesh, a former U.S. Marine who has a segment on RT called "Adam vs. The Man." "We have some good news from the front lines of the Ron Paul 'LOVEaluation' with our money bomb on June 5.
